Residential Roof Cleaning in Vancouver, WA
Residential roof cleaning services involve the removal of dirt, moss, algae, and other buildup from the surface of a home's roof. This process typically covers various roofing materials, including asphalt shingles, tile, and metal, helping to restore the roof’s appearance and prevent potential damage caused by organic growth and debris. Property owners interested in roof cleaning usually want to understand the scope of cleaning, the methods used, and how it can extend the lifespan of their roof. It’s important to consider the condition of the roof beforehand, as heavily damaged or aging roofs may require additional repairs or replacement.
Homeowners often request roof cleaning to improve curb appeal and maintain the integrity of their property. Before requesting this service, it’s helpful to know the current state of the roof, including any areas with persistent moss or algae, as well as any nearby landscaping or delicate features that might be affected during cleaning. Understanding the type of roofing material and its specific cleaning needs can also ensure the right approach is used to achieve the best results without causing damage.

Residential Roof Cleaning Questions
What is residential roof cleaning? It involves removing dirt, moss, algae, and debris from roof surfaces to improve appearance and prevent damage.
Why should homeowners consider roof cleaning? Regular cleaning helps extend the roof's lifespan and maintains the property's curb appeal.
What types of roofs can be cleaned? Most common roof types, including asphalt shingles, tile, and metal, can be cleaned effectively.
Is roof cleaning safe for the roof? When performed properly, roof cleaning is safe and helps preserve the roof's integrity over time.
